“The shift to housing as the first answer to homelessness was adopted by California with equally abysmal outcomes. Homelessness elevated from about 139,000 statewide in 2007 to 161,548 within the newest rely. Even though California homes simply 12% of the U.S. inhabitants, the numbers present it now has 27% of the nation’s complete homeless inhabitants.”
Some politicians have claimed that it’s California’s gentle climate that has drawn the homeless to the state however “Florida, Georgia and Texas, different states with usually gentle climate, all noticed their homeless populations decline throughout this identical interval.”
“As a lot as California leaders hate to have our state in comparison with Texas, in the event that they need to know what works, they need to go to San Antonio….San Antonio and better Bexar County developed a systemic method to the issue involving emergency medical providers, native hospitals, legislation enforcement, psychological well being assets, and nonprofit service suppliers. As a substitute of working in silos, they work collectively, in coordination with a communitywide nonprofit group, Haven for Hope of Bexar County , which gives providers based mostly on the wants of every particular person. This system doesn’t ignore housing, however it additionally doesn’t overemphasize it. Because the effort turned operational in 2010, the county has seen an 11% decline in complete homelessness and a 77% decline in unsheltered homelessness in downtown San Antonio.
Packages comparable to this are designed for fulfillment moderately than in accordance with no matter method is in political favor. Additionally they don’t simply throw cash on the downside: They set objectives and use metrics based mostly on outcomes to trace and reward success. Within the course of, the streets turn out to be safer and extra livable, whereas homeless folks get the assistance they want.”
